What would happen to the volume of a gas if you increased the temperature?

Answers

Answer 1

Answer:

The volume of the gas increases as the temperature increases.

Explanation:

Gas volume does increase with increasing temperature providing that the pressure remains constant. Temperature and pressure both interact with the gas volume according to the gas Laws and both variables must be accounted for at the same time.

The option that best describes a galvanic cell is that a battery containing a spontaneous redox reaction. That is option C.

A Galvanic cell is simply defined as an electrochemical cell that uses the movement of electrons in a reduction-oxidation reaction to produce electrical energy for use.

A Galvanic cell is a battery and is made up of a conducting electrolyte solution and two halve cells which include:

one half-cell of metal A(anode) electrode andone half-cell of metal B(cathode) electrode.

In the galvanic cell a spontaneous redox reaction occurs which involves the transfer of electrons from anode to cathode with the release of energy.

Therefore, the option that best describes a galvanic cell is that it is a battery containing a spontaneous redox reaction.

What is the definition of climate?
1) An area's long term weather pattern
2)When large air masses of different density, moisture, and temperature mee
3)The state of the atmosphere at a given place and time
4)Large volume of air that has similar characteristics of temperature and water
vapor content

Answers

Answer:

1) An area's long term weather pattern

Explanation:

Climate is defined as the weather pattern in an area for the long term. Climate means the usual condition of the humidity, temperature, wind, rainfall, and atmospheric pressure in the surface area of Earth for the long term. Usually the time period for a climate in a region is taken over 30-years.

Weather is the state of the atmosphere and climate the long-term weather pattern of the area. For example: degree to which it is hot or cold is weather and expect snow in the Northeast in every January is climate.

Hence, the correct answer is "1) An area's long term weather pattern".

A compound is found to contain 26.73 % phosphorus, 12.09 % nitrogen, and 61.18 % chlorine by mass. What is the empirical formula for this compound

Answers

Answer:

[tex]PNCl_2[/tex]

Explanation:

Hello!

In this case, when determining empirical formulas by knowing the by-mass percent, we first must assume the percentages as masses so we can compute the moles of each element:

[tex]n_P=\frac{26.73g}{30.97g/mol}=0.863mol\\\\n_N=\frac{12.09g}{14.01g/mol}=0.863mol\\\\n_C_l=\frac{61.18g}{35.45g/mol}=1.726mol[/tex]

Now, for the determination of the subscript of each element in the empirical formula, we divide the moles by the fewest moles (P or N):

[tex]P=\frac{0.863mol}{0.863mol}=1\\\\N= \frac{0.863mol}{0.863mol}=1\\\\Cl=\frac{1.726mol}{0.863mol}2[/tex]

Thus, the empirical formula is:

[tex]PNCl_2[/tex]

And electro chemical cell has the following standard cell notation:
Mg(s) | Mg2+ (aq) || Ag+(aq)| Ag(s)

Write a balanced redox reaction for the cells using the oxidation and reduction half reactions. (be sure to equalize charge by multiplying the correct number before adding and simplifying)

Answers

2Ag⁺(aq) + Mg(s)→ 2Ag(s) + Mg²⁺ (aq)

Further explanation

Given

Standard cell notation:

Mg(s) | Mg2+ (aq) || Ag+(aq)| Ag(s)

Required

a balanced redox reaction

Solution

At the cathode the reduction reaction occurs, the anode oxidation reaction occurs

In reaction:  

Ag⁺ + Mg → Ag + Mg²⁺  

half-reactions

at the cathode (reduction reaction)

Ag⁺ (aq) + e⁻ ---> Ag (s)  x2

2Ag⁺ (aq) + 2e⁻ ---> 2Ag (s)

at the anode (oxidation reaction)

Mg (s) → Mg²⁺ (aq) + 2e−

a balanced cell reaction

2Ag⁺(aq) + Mg(s)→ 2Ag(s) + Mg²⁺ (aq)

If 8.50 g of phosphorus reacts with hydrogen gas at 2.00 atm in a 10.0-L container at 298 K, calculate the moles of PH3 produced as well as the total number of moles of gas present at the conclusion of the reaction.

Answers

Answer:

The moles of PH₃ produced are 0.2742 and the total number of moles of gas present at the end of the reaction is 0.6809.

Explanation:

Phosphorus reacts with H₂ according to the balanced equation:

P₄ (s) + 6 H₂ (g) ⇒ 4 PH₃ (g)

By stoichiometry of the reaction (that is, the relationship between the amount of reagents and products in a chemical reaction), the following amounts of each compound participate in the reaction:

P₄: 1 moleH₂: 6 molesPH₃:4 moles

Being the molar mass of the compounds:

P₄: 124 g/moleH₂: 2 g/molePH₃: 34 g/mole

The following mass amounts of each compound participate in the reaction:

P₄: 1 mole* 124 g/mole= 124 gH₂: 6 mole* 2 g/mole= 12 gPH₃: 4 moles* 34 g/mole= 136 g

An ideal gas is characterized by three state variables: absolute pressure (P), volume (V), and absolute temperature (T). The relationship between them constitutes the ideal gas law, an equation that relates the three variables if the amount of substance, number of moles n, remains constant and where R is the molar constant of the gases:

P * V = n * R * T

In this case you know:

P= 2 atmV= 10 Ln= ?R= 0.082 [tex]\frac{atm*L}{mol*K}[/tex]T= 298 K

Replacing:

2 atm*10 L= n*0.082 [tex]\frac{atm*L}{mol*K}[/tex] *298 K

and solving you get:

[tex]n=\frac{2 atm*10 L}{0.082\frac{atm*L}{mol*K}*298 K }[/tex]

n=0.818 moles

The limiting reagent is one that is consumed first in its entirety, determining the amount of product in the reaction. When the limiting reagent is finished, the chemical reaction will stop.

To determine the limiting reagent, you can use a simple rule of three as follows: if 6 moles of H₂ react with 124 g of P₄, 0.818 moles of H₂ with how much mass of P₄ will it react?

[tex]mass of P_{4}=\frac{0.818 moles of H_{2}*124 grams of P_{4}}{6 moles of H_{2}}[/tex]

mass of P₄= 16.90 grams

But 16.90 grams of P₄ are not available, 8.50 grams are available. Since you have less mass than you need to react with 0.818 moles of H₂, phosphorus P₄ will be the limiting reagent.

Then you can apply the following rules of three:

If 124 grams of P₄ produce 4 moles of PH₃, 8.50 grams of P₄, how many moles do they produce?

[tex]moles of PH_{3} =\frac{8.5 grams of P_{4}*4 moles of PH_{3} }{124grams of P_{4}}[/tex]

moles of PH₃=0.2742

If 124 grams of P₄ react with 6 moles of H₂, 8.50 grams of P₄ with how many moles of H₂ do they react?

[tex]moles of H_{2} =\frac{8.5 grams of P_{4}*6 moles of H_{2} }{124grams of P_{4}}[/tex]

moles of H₂= 0.4113

If you have 0.818 moles of H₂, the number of moles of gas H₂ present at the end of the reaction is calculated as:

0.818 - 0.4113= 0.4067

Then the total number of moles of gas present at the end of the reaction will be the sum of the moles of PH₃ gas and H₂ gas that did not react:

0.2742 + 0.4067= 0.6809

Finally, the moles of PH₃ produced are 0.2742 and the total number of moles of gas present at the end of the reaction is 0.6809.
